다음을 통해 공유


식 계산기를 구현합니다.

식을 평가 하는 디버그 엔진 (DE), 기호 공급자 (SP), 바인더 개체 및 식 계산기 (EE) 자체 사이 복잡 한 상호 작용입니다. 이러한 네 가지 구성 요소는 하나의 구성 요소에 의해 구현 되 고 다른 소비 되는 인터페이스에 연결 되어 있습니다.

EE 식 DE 문자열의 형태로 걸립니다 구문 분석 또는 평가. EE DE가 사용 되는 다음 인터페이스를 구현 합니다.

EE를 DE에서 기호 및 개체의 값을 가져오는 제공 된 바인더 개체를 호출 합니다. EE DE에서 구현 되는 다음 인터페이스를 사용 합니다.

EE 구현 IDebugProperty2. IDebugProperty2지역 변수, 기본, 또는 Visual Studio, 다음에 적절 한 정보를 표시 하는 개체는 식 계산의 결과 설명 하는 메커니즘을 제공의 지역, 조사식, 또는 직접 실행 창입니다.

정보를 요청 하면 SP는 EE에 DE에서 지정 됩니다. SP 주소 및 다음 인터페이스 및 해당 파생물과 같은 필드를 설명 하는 인터페이스를 구현 합니다.

EE 모든 이러한 인터페이스를 사용합니다.

단원 내용

참고 항목

기타 리소스

공용 언어 런타임에서 식 계산기를 작성